What Happened

Spark Minda, a prominent auto components maker, announced a substantial investment of Rs 1,166 crore to establish two new manufacturing units in the YEIDA region. These facilities will focus on producing ignition switch-cum-steering locks and mechatronic components. Additionally, a joint venture with Toyodenso will set up another plant in Noida, collectively aiming to create 6,440 jobs.
